Trenton Hilbrock Stermer, 33, of Kalamazoo, passed away on May 14, 2026.
Born on February 16, 1993, Trenton was known for his adventurous spirit, generous heart, and deeply unique personality. He believed in living life his own way and never hesitated to follow his own path. Whether through his love of travel, snowboarding, music, festivals, healthy eating, or holistic health, Trenton embraced life with curiosity, passion, and individuality.
Above all else, Trenton was a devoted father to his daughter, Alora. She was the center of his world, and he always wanted the very best for her. He dreamed of giving her a happy, meaningful life filled with love, opportunity, and strong family connections. Trenton cared deeply about bringing family together and creating moments where the people he loved could laugh, share meals, and enjoy each other’s company. He especially loved taking friends and family out to dinner, making memories that will now be cherished forever.
Trenton also shared a special bond with his beloved dog, Gemma, who brought him constant companionship and joy. He had a strong and loving connection with his brothers, Trevor and Cory, and treasured the bond they shared throughout his life. The love he gave to his family reflected the caring and loyal person he was.
He was preceded in death by his father, Todd Joseph Stermer, and many find comfort in knowing they are reunited once again.
Visitation services will be held from 11:00 a.m. to 1:00 p.m., followed by a service at 1:00 p.m. on Friday, May 22, 2026, at the funeral home. Burial services will immediately follow at 2:00 p.m. at City of Portage South Cemetery.
In honor of Trenton’s love for his daughter, donations will be established to support Alora’s future. Please make any checks payable to Trevor Stermer.
He will be deeply missed and forever loved by his daughter, family, friends, and all who knew him.
